The response of gas-filled position-sensitive detectors consists not only of the main Gaussian response (FWHM ~0.1 mm) but also of a linear exponential term measurable up to 7 mm from the excitation, superimposed on an incoherent background. This effect depends on gas type and pressure and is due to fluorescence of the detection gas. The consequences of this effect on some standard experimental methods used in small-angle X-ray scattering (SAXS), i.e. Porod limit and Guinier radii determination, are investigated.
